1995 Alfa Romeo 155 vs. 1950 Austin A135
To start off, 1995 Alfa Romeo 155 is newer by 45 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1950 Austin A135.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1950 Austin A135 would be higher. At 3,993 cc (6 cylinders), 1950 Austin A135 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1950 Austin A135 (124 HP) has 6 more horse power than 1995 Alfa Romeo 155. (118 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1950 Austin A135 should accelerate faster than 1995 Alfa Romeo 155.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1950 Austin A135 weights approximately 814 kg more than 1995 Alfa Romeo 155.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
